We stayed in this Hotel in April 2014. For the rates we paid, the accommodation was quite reasonable- the hotel was clean and neat, although it could do with a small bit of TLC. It was reminiscent of a time gone past, so definitely had an air of nostalgia to it.
Towels were provided for us, and something which I have not seen for a very long time- a small Lux soap bar- was also provided. (Not many hotels do complimentary soap anymore.) Bedding was clean and the room was tidy too.
The breakfast service in the morning was good, and the staff was friendly as well, and we had a comfortable stay.
The manager was quite helpful in booking and confirming rates online, which was a real plus- and card facilities are available to pay for your stay.
Location is quite central to the rest of town, so getting around is very easy- the staff were also quite helpful in pointing out local attractions as well. The directions I was given were very easy to follow as well.
Parking was out in the street, which didn't really bother us, as night-staff have a clear view of the exit and parking in front of the front door.
The hotel only provides breakfast so lunch and supper will be yours, although there is no shortage of places in town to visit for food- most of them are within walking distance as well.
If you’re in the area and need a place to stay- well worth it. I’ll definitely go back if I am in the area.
